Refilling instructions for
Kyocera TK540K, TK540C, TK540M, TK540Y models -
putting in the powder is
fairly easy, however, it is a practical task requiring some basic tools

(1)
you require to make a hole
into the cartridge using the "Hole Making Tool"
(2) Using a poly bag shake
the remaining powder inside the cartridge into the bag - seal and
discard
(3)
Fit the filler spout onto the bottle - cap it - shake the bottle - uncap
then you simply pour in powder
(4) Be careful not to
Overfill - Recap the bottle - Then seal the hole made into the cartridge
with tape
(5) If chip has expired
fit a new chip - some customers tell us that they do it without
replacing the chip
Always
refill on a surface which can tolerate any spillage.
Generally, it may be a
good idea to put in less powder than to "overfill" - but ensure that you are
refilling an "empty" - not a half filled cartridge! Always shake the
toner bottle vigorously before pouring - this makes the powder flow like
liquid.
Resetting the cartridge to
"Full"
Kyocera TK540K, TK540C, TK540M, TK540Y
-
Have a "Killer Chip"
on the cartridge -
Simply remove the expired chip and fit the new one in it's place There
is one chip per cartridge. Some say that if the cartridges are kept
topped up with toner the chip will last longer - we cannot verify this. |
